Shreyas Iyer may not be able to take part in the forthcoming ODI series against Australia. The middle-order batter, who was not able to bat in India's first innings at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Motera on Sunday due to back pain, may be ruled out of the limited-overs leg of the series. 

The three-match ODI series begins on March 17 with the first game in Mumbai. Iyer has been suffering from recurring back pain for a few months now, and whether he will be fit in time for IPL 2023 depends on the results of his scan. 

The BCCI said in a statement that the medical team is monitoring the batter.

"Shreyas Iyer complained of pain in his lower back following the third day's play. He has gone for scans and the BCCI Medical Team is monitoring him," the BCCI statement on Sunday morning read. 

As per reports, the results of the scans aren’t positive and the batter will now have to undergo further tests.

Iyer’s absence was not missed much in Ahmedabad, where Virat Kohli and Axar Patel shared a 162-run stand for the seventh wicket. India ended day three with comfortable lead of 91 runs.

The middle order batter has been bogged down with injuries in the past as well. He missed the entire IPL 2021 due to injury, which also cost him his Delhi Capitals captaincy. 

This season of the IPL, he is set to captain KKR, who spent a whopping Rs 12.25 crore at the mega auction to acquire his services. He has also missed a couple of bilateral series in the past due to injuries.
